Emory Model (TIPSS)

About

This model was developed as a retrospective analysis of all patients undergoing TIPSS placement at one center over a 2 ½ year period. When compared to the MELD and Child Pugh score, all three scoring systems predicted short term mortality after TIPSS relatively consistently, however, long term mortality was not as accurate with the Emory score as with the MELD or Child Pugh.
